- Abstract
- In this study, 21 energy reduction factors were selected as architecture, system & operation, and lighting and equipment parts to analyze reduction method of the load occurring in office buildings. Energy consumption simulation was performed. In the architecture part, saving rate (1.53%) of “occupant density” factor was the most efficient. In the system and operation part, saving rate (1.28%) of “interior VAV and exterior FPU type” factor was the most efficient. In case of lighting and equipment part, saving rate (12.42%) of “schedule” factor was the most efficient. In the three parts, saving rate of the lighting and equipment part was 27.32%. This was caused by the “schedule” factor. Saving rates of the architecture part and the system and operation part were 3.39% and 1.20%, respectively.
